Endorsement: Clay Whittle, Sheriff

Posted: Sunday, July 18, 2004

Editor:

I have been a member of the Columbia County Sheriff's Office for 10 years. My duty assignments have included the Road Patrol, Criminal Investigations Division and Special Operations Division. I have been a supervisor for four years and I am currently serving in the Internal Affairs Division.

During this time, I have observed Sheriff Clay Whittle and his leadership capabilities. Whittle has been strong and consistent through the good times and the bad. Whittle is a firm believer in the philosophy of community policing and has developed many programs to better serve the citizens of Columbia County.

Whittle has also implemented extensive departmental training in the area of community policing. He wants the deputies of the Columbia County Sheriff's Office to understand that they serve the citizens of this community. He insists on courtesy and professionalism. Whittle also stands behind the deputies whom he employs. No system is perfect, and any organization with more than 300 employees has its problems. Whittle does not run or hide from this challenge and leads by example.

During a training session at the Sheriff's Office, the instructor stated the definition of a leader is a person you would follow to a place that you would not go alone. I have in the past and will continue in the future to follow the leadership of Sheriff Whittle.

Keith E. Cox

Martinez
